1. The Full-Body Blast: 15 Minute Fat Workout
This total-body routine alternates between upper body, lower body, and core exercises:
- Jump Squats (45 seconds) - explosive lower body
- Push-Ups (45 seconds) - chest and arms
- Mountain Climbers (45 seconds) - core and cardio
- Plank Shoulder Taps (45 seconds) - core stability
- Burpees (45 seconds) - full-body explosive move
Repeat the circuit 3 times with 15 seconds rest between exercises. This 15 minute fat workout burns approximately 150-200 calories.

3. The Beginner-Friendly: 15 Minute Fat Workout
New to exercise? This modified routine is perfect for starters:
- March in Place (1 minute) - warm-up
- Wall Push-Ups (45 seconds)
- Chair Squats (45 seconds)
- Standing Crunches (45 seconds)
- Step Touches (1 minute) - cool down
Repeat 3 times. As you progress, increase intensity by adding jumps or removing support.

5. The Tabata Inferno: 15 Minute Fat Workout
Based on the famous Tabata protocol (20 sec work/10 sec rest):
- Squat Jumps
- Push-Ups
- Plank Jacks
- Lunges
Complete 8 rounds total (4 exercises × 2 rounds each). This scientifically-proven method from Tabata's research delivers maximum results in minimum time.

Maximizing Results From Your 15 Minute Fat Workouts
To get the most from your 15 minute fat workouts:
- Go intense: You should be breathless by the end
- Be consistent: Aim for at least 4-5 sessions weekly
- Combine with proper nutrition: No workout can out-train a bad diet
- Progress gradually: Increase difficulty as you get fitter
- Stay hydrated: Drink water before, during, and after
